Handover: tile prefetcher for Lattermap. Prefetches zoom levels 12–16 along the planned route, capped at 80 MB per session. Cache eviction is LRU; don't touch the stale-tile check without running the soak test. Branch is ready for review. Ping the owner named below with any questions.

named custodian: Brivan Eliath Quenox Frador

## Runbook: Connection Pool Changes

Plugin authors integrating with the Ostermill data layer: release 7.1 caps per-plugin pool size at twelve connections and enforces a two-second acquisition timeout. Audit your plugins for long-held connections and release them promptly, or requests will queue and time out. After updating, run the pool stress check in the sandbox. Signed plugin packages only — sign your archive with the key below.

release key, fafof-hawip: bky6_52YEwQ

Hi Mireille — handover for the Fathomdiff release. The large-file diff viewer now streams chunks instead of loading whole blobs, so the 2 GB fixture tests finally pass. One caveat: memory spikes on binary diffs are still under investigation, tracked in the Halcourt board. Release artifacts must be signed with the key that follows.

deploy key for kajof-fajop: bky6_gDHw9Q

## Idempotency Keys for Payment Retries (Lumopay)

Every retry of a charge request must reuse the original idempotency key; generating a new key on retry can produce duplicate charges. Keys are scoped per merchant and expire after 48 hours. Reviewers should verify keys are derived server-side, never from client input. The full key-generation specification and threat model are maintained on the internal page.

dashboard of kaguf-tawip = https://vault.merlaqsys.test/issue